The Many Benefits Of Stainless Steel Windows

stainless steel windows are a popular choice for many homeowners and businesses due to their durability, strength, and aesthetic appeal. Made from a combination of steel, chromium, and other materials, stainless steel windows offer numerous advantages over other window materials such as aluminum or wood. In this article, we will explore the many benefits of stainless steel windows and why they are an excellent choice for any building.

One of the primary advantages of stainless steel windows is their durability. Unlike other materials that may warp, crack, or rot over time, stainless steel windows are incredibly robust and have a long lifespan. This makes them an ideal choice for buildings in harsh environments or high-traffic areas where they may be subject to wear and tear. stainless steel windows are also resistant to corrosion, rust, and fading, making them a low-maintenance option that will retain their appearance for many years.

In addition to their durability, stainless steel windows are also known for their strength. The steel frame of these windows provides excellent structural support, making them a secure choice for any building. This added strength also allows for larger window sizes and configurations, providing more natural light and better views for occupants. stainless steel windows can withstand extreme weather conditions, impacts, and pressures, making them an excellent choice for buildings that require high-performance windows.

Another benefit of stainless steel windows is their aesthetic appeal. The sleek, modern look of stainless steel complements a variety of architectural styles and design aesthetics. Whether used in a residential home, commercial building, or industrial facility, stainless steel windows add a touch of sophistication and elegance to any space. The clean lines and minimalistic design of stainless steel windows make them a versatile option that can enhance the overall appearance of a building.

Stainless steel windows are also environmentally friendly. The steel used in these windows is recyclable and can be repurposed into new products, reducing waste and environmental impact. Additionally, stainless steel is a sustainable material that has a low carbon footprint compared to other window materials. By choosing stainless steel windows, homeowners and businesses can contribute to a greener future and reduce their ecological footprint.

Stainless steel windows are also easy to maintain and clean. The smooth surface of stainless steel resists dust, dirt, and grime, making it easy to wipe down with a damp cloth or mild detergent. Unlike wood or aluminum windows that may require repainting or refinishing over time, stainless steel windows retain their appearance with minimal effort. This low-maintenance quality makes stainless steel windows a practical choice for busy homeowners and commercial property managers.
